You can backdate a tax rebate claim for … WebIf you live in England, Wales or Northern Ireland and you have taxable income of more than £50,001, you will have to pay the higher rate of 40 per cent tax on the amount above £50,001 up to £150,000. If you live in Scotland you will have to pay the higher rate of 41 per cent tax on the amount above £43,431 up to £150,000. If you’re an employee, a common reason for paying too much tax is being given an incorrect PAYE code. Often, this is down to receiving an emergency tax code when you start a new job. razor gen 2 4.5x27 shot show 2014
